DISCUSSION / BACKGROUND
On April 22, 2025, the Board adopted Resolution 045-2025, designating parking restrictions for County-owned or operated parking lots. Upon further review, the recommendation was made to clarify the language regarding parking at 360 Fair Lane, specifically as it relates to exceptions for parking spaces designated for the Veteran Memorial. A change was made to Table 1, Parking Lot Location, to say "360 Fair Lane, excepting those parking spaces designated for Veteran Memorial parking as restricted in Section 2," replacing the previous language of "360 Fair Lane, excepting visitors to the Veterans Memorial." This language clarifies that Veteran Memorial parking is still restricted as noted in Table 2 (i.e. no parking between 9 p.m. and 6 a.m. any day and time-restricted 2-hour parking between 6:00 a.m. and 9:00 p.m. on Saturday and Sunday). In addition to this change, 300 Fair Lane is also being added to Table 1. 300 Fair Lane is the lower parking lot adjacent to Building A that used to serve the old Sheriff Administrative Facility. There are no other changes to the Resolution.
ALTERNATIVES
The Board could choose not to adopt this Resolution, leaving the exception regarding the designated parking spaces at the Veterans Memorial located at 360 Fair Lane without further clarification and 300 Fair Lane would not have any parking restrictions.
